Qld passes deadline on coronavirus cluster – Seymour Telegraph

Queensland’s aged care homes can now reopen to visitors, with authorities confident two infected teens who dodged quarantine did not spread coronavirus.Health authorities had been on high alert for an outbreak linked to the women who spent a week moving around the community after returning from Melbourne in July.”Today was the very important day,” Premier Annastacia Palaszczuk said, referring to the end of the two-week period since police placed the women in isolation.
